A Custom of Excellence
Germany’s involvement in bobsled commenced inside the early twentieth century, with roots in the two West and East Germany just before reunification in 1990. The two areas experienced aggressive packages, but their unification introduced jointly top-tier coaching, athlete enhancement, and cutting-edge know-how. The result was a powerhouse which includes persistently dominated international competitions.

Considering that the inception of Olympic bobsled in 1924, Germany has accrued more Olympic medals within the sport than some other nation. Names like André Lange, Kevin Kuske, and Francesco Friedrich are actually legendary, possessing assisted cement Germany’s standing as a global chief in the Activity.

The Golden Period
Potentially no period illustrates Germany’s supremacy a lot more than the twenty first century. André Lange, normally regarded as the greatest bobsled pilot in heritage, received four Olympic golds and a person silver between 2002 and 2010. His mix of quiet under pressure and flawless driving impressed a fresh generation.

That new technology was led by Francesco Friedrich, a phenomenon in fashionable bobsledding. Beginning his Olympic journey in 2014, Friedrich has given that won multiple gold medals and Environment Championships in both equally the two-man and 4-guy situations. His dominance has drawn comparisons to Michael Schumacher in System 1 or Usain Bolt over the observe.

Females’s Bobsled Success
Germany has also excelled in Gals’s bobsled Because the event was extra towards the Olympics in 2002. Sandra Kiriasis, on the list of sport’s most prosperous woman pilots, claimed gold in 2006. In 2018, Mariama Jamanka ongoing the custom, winning Olympic gold in the two-girl event in PyeongChang. The introduction of monobob for the 2022 Olympics opened Yet one more prospect, with German athletes once more contending for podium finishes.

Engineering and Precision
German excellence in bobsled isn’t limited to athletic expertise. The nation’s engineering abilities performs a crucial job. Sleds are created with the assistance of aerospace and automotive engineers, such as partnerships with firms like BMW. Every curve, every single gram of bodyweight, and every inch w 88 of metal is optimized for velocity, steadiness, and Command.

German tracks like Altenberg, Winterberg, and the now-ruined Königssee have prolonged served as proving grounds for elite expertise. These services are not just teaching sites—they’re laboratories for refining approach and screening sled effectiveness under genuine situations.
